Estate planning refers to the process of preparing for the management and distribution of your assets in the event of death or incapacity. An estate plan can help minimize the taxes and expenses incurred in the dispersion of your assets. It also allows you to designate how your assets will be distributed among your heirs, making the process easier and less stressful for your friends and family to endure. While California generally recognizes out-of-state wills if they were validly executed under that state’s laws, it is highly risky to rely on them. California is a community property state, which significantly alters how assets are treated compared to “common law” states. To ensure your Huntington Beach estate plan functions as intended and avoids unnecessary litigation, a local attorney should review your documents to align them with the California Probate Code.
Proposition 19 significantly changed the rules for transferring property to children without triggering a property tax reassessment. In high-value areas like Huntington Beach, failing to account for these rules can result in a massive tax burden for your heirs. A strategic estate plan can utilize specific trust structures to help mitigate the impact of reassessments, ensuring your family home remains affordable for the next generation.
Traditional estate plans often overlook digital assets. In California, the Revised Fiduciary Access to Digital Assets Act (RFADAA) governs who can access your online presence. Your Huntington Beach estate plan should include specific language granting your executor or trustee the authority to manage “digital property,” including crypto-wallets, monetized social media accounts, and cloud storage, to prevent these assets from being locked forever.
Beyond major life events like marriage, divorce, or the birth of a child, you should review your plan every 3 to 5 years. Changes in federal estate tax exemptions or California-specific statutes (such as new healthcare directive requirements) can render older documents obsolete. Regular updates ensure your power of attorney and successor trustee designations still reflect your current relationships and wishes.
Simply leaving assets “outright” to heirs provides no protection from their future legal troubles. By establishing a Lifetime Beneficiary Trust within your estate plan, you can ensure that the assets remain in the family bloodline. This structure allows your children to benefit from the inheritance while shielding the principal from judgment creditors, bankruptcy, or claims from a former spouse during a divorce proceeding.
